The Power Of Coaching For Performance: How To Unlock Your Full Potential

In today’s fast-paced and competitive business world, organizations are constantly seeking ways to maximize productivity and drive performance. One effective strategy that has gained popularity in recent years is coaching for performance. This approach involves providing employees with individualized support and guidance to help them reach their full potential and achieve their goals.

coaching for performance is not just about correcting mistakes or addressing weaknesses. Instead, it focuses on building on employees’ strengths, developing their skills, and empowering them to take ownership of their own development. By working closely with a coach, employees can identify areas for improvement, set clear and achievable goals, and receive ongoing feedback and support to help them succeed.

One of the key benefits of coaching for performance is that it encourages a growth mindset. Instead of viewing challenges as obstacles, employees are encouraged to see them as opportunities for learning and growth. This mindset shift can have a significant impact on employee motivation and engagement, leading to improved performance and job satisfaction.

coaching for performance is also a highly personalized approach to development. Rather than taking a one-size-fits-all approach, coaches work with employees to create tailored development plans that address their unique strengths, weaknesses, and goals. This individualized support can help employees make rapid progress and see tangible results in a short amount of time.

Furthermore, coaching for performance can help employees develop essential skills such as communication, time management, and leadership. By working with a coach, employees can receive guidance on how to improve these skills and apply them in their day-to-day work. This can not only benefit the individual employee but also contribute to the overall success of the organization.

Another key aspect of coaching for performance is the emphasis on continuous improvement. Coaching is not a one-time event but an ongoing process that requires dedication and commitment from both the coach and the employee. By regularly reviewing progress, setting new goals, and adjusting strategies as needed, employees can continue to grow and develop over time.

In order for coaching for performance to be successful, it is essential for organizations to create a supportive and empowering environment. Employees need to feel safe and comfortable sharing their goals, challenges, and aspirations with their coach. They also need to receive constructive feedback in a timely and respectful manner in order to make meaningful progress.

Managers and leaders play a crucial role in fostering a culture of coaching within their organizations. By providing the necessary resources and support, managers can help employees access coaching services and maximize their potential. In addition, managers can serve as role models by actively participating in coaching sessions themselves and demonstrating the value of continuous learning and development.
